Veronica Phaneuf, President
I’m Veronica Phaneuf. I started About-Face Computers over twenty-five years ago in my home in Montague Center.
At the time I wanted to use my aptitude for math and technology in a way that would allow me to work in a service business while raising my young son. I have enjoyed many years of challenging rapid technical change while trying to keep our focus on Service.
Since About-Face Computer Solutions opened its store, I have been able to spend time as well on my Quickbooks / financial consulting business that developed as I worked with business customers and their technology. The need for help with Quickbooks and other business software interested me and I have been pursuing that as well over the years. I currently act as the business manager of The Greenfield Center School in Greenfield, a private, non-profit Elementary School, this along with my other pursuits.
I came to that point in life with a Bachelor in Science and experience in a diversity of jobs. I had worked in many factories and printing companies in my high school and college years. I spent five years in a management position for the Commonwealth of Massachusetts and worked as a Librarian in Montague Center for several years. Montague has been my home since 1986 and I am proud of our town and its growth over the years. As a Town Meeting member for many years, I’ve been able to keep involved in town business and activities. I currently serve on the board of MCTV and have served on the Boards of the Montague Reporter and The Brick House as well.
Having the store in Turners Falls feels like the right place. With the addition of Brian Faldasz as my business partner the move to Avenue A was a great transition. We’ve been available to serve more of the community and are seeing new customers from Montague and surrounding towns regularly. I am hoping to continue serving the many towns in Franklin County for years to come.
